Around 150 world leaders gather in New York City for the third day of the High-level General Debate in the 79th Session of the UN General Assembly (UNGA) on Thursday, September 26. Palestinian President Mahmoud Abbas is expected to deliver a speech along with the leaders of Kenya, Sudan, and South Sudan during the morning session. Lebanese foreign minister Abdallah Bouhabib will speak along with the leaders of Iraq, Japan, and the European Union in the afternoon session.
